“We are convinced that today the only mechanism in Syria that has allowed us to seriously reduce the level of violence and take a step towards establishing stability is the Astana process,” Zarifa quoted the agency IRNA.

The minister said that a meeting in this format should be held as soon as possible.

He also added that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ov confirmed this need during a telephone conversation with him.

Earlier, the Russian Foreign Ministry said that Moscow is committed to strictly fulfilling its obligations under the Astana process and the Idlib memorandum.
